Timestamp datasets and results for research integrity.

Reproducibility and priority both depend on fixing what you had and when. Blockchain notarization gives researchers tamper-evident, independently verifiable timestamps for datasets, code, and results.

Why it works here

Registering the fingerprint of a dataset or a pre-analysis plan proves it existed before you saw the outcomes — a defense against accusations of p-hacking or post-hoc revision — and establishes priority for a finding. Anchoring the exact data files also strengthens reproducibility: anyone can confirm the data used later matches the data notarized.

Because files are hashed locally, even sensitive or embargoed data can be notarized without exposure. For large collections, timestamp a manifest of file hashes. Automate it in a pipeline via the API.

Common scenarios

Pre-register an analysis plan

Notarize the plan before collecting outcomes to evidence it predated the results.

Fix a dataset for reproducibility

Anchor the exact data so others can confirm they are using the same bytes.

Establish a discovery’s priority

Timestamp results to evidence when a finding existed.
